Skyresh Bolgolam is a character in Jonathan Swift's novel "Gulliver's Travels." He is the principal secretary of state and Lord High Admiral of Lilliput. Bolgolam is a political opponent of Gulliver and plays a significant role in the conflict between Gulliver and the Lilliputians.

Which people in Gulliver's Travels most often represent English political figures?

In "Gulliver's Travels," the Lilliputians often represent English political figures, particularly members of the Whig and Tory parties. The Lilliputian Emperor represents King George I, while other characters like Flimnap and Skyresh Bolgolam are believed to resemble real-life political figures at the time, such as Robert Walpole and Lord Bolingbroke.
